Understanding Kalshi Exchange and Its Core Principles
Kalshi is a regulated futures exchange that allows users to trade on the outcome of future events. Unlike traditional exchanges dealing with stocks or commodities, Kalshi focuses on "event contracts," which pay out based on whether a specific event happens or doesn't. This market structure is designed to be transparent and efficient, providing clear price discovery based on aggregated user predictions. Participants buy and sell contracts representing their beliefs about the probability of an event occurring. These contracts are denominated in U.S. dollars, enhancing accessibility for a broad range of traders. The exchange operates under regulatory oversight, offering a level of security and legitimacy often lacking in decentralized prediction platforms.
The core principle driving Kalshi’s functionality is the "wisdom of the crowd." The collective predictions of participants, reflected in the contract prices, often prove surprisingly accurate. The market incentivizes participants to provide informed opinions, as correct predictions translate to profits. This contrasts sharply with traditional polls or surveys, which can be susceptible to bias or limited sample sizes. Kalshi allows individuals to not only express their opinions but also financially benefit from their accuracy. It's a dynamic ecosystem where information and analysis are continuously priced into the market, creating what many believe is an efficient forecast of potential outcomes.
The Regulatory Landscape of Prediction Markets
The regulatory environment surrounding prediction markets is evolving, and Kalshi operates within a specific framework established by the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C). This oversight provides a degree of investor protection and ensures fair market practices. The CFTC's involvement also introduces certain compliance requirements for the exchange and its users. It's important for traders to understand these regulations, particularly regarding account verification, margin requirements, and reporting obligations. The regulated nature of Kalshi distinguishes it from some other platforms in the prediction market space, lending credibility and attracting a wider range of participants. Navigating this framework builds trust and fosters a more professional trading environment.
The recent granting of a Designated Contract Market (DCM) license by the CFTC was a pivotal moment for Kalshi. This license allows Kalshi to offer contracts on a wider range of events, including political outcomes. However, this expansion has also brought increased scrutiny and debate about the potential societal impact of trading on political events. Transparency in operations and adherence to regulatory guidelines are paramount for Kalshi as it continues to innovate and expand its offerings.

The Role of Information and Analysis in Prediction Markets
The quality of information is paramount in prediction markets. Unlike traditional markets where company fundamentals often drive prices, prediction markets rely heavily on anticipating future events. Staying informed about relevant news, data, and expert opinions is crucial for making accurate predictions. This involves actively seeking out diverse sources of information and critically evaluating their credibility. Utilizing specialized research tools, analytical platforms, and data visualization techniques can help distill complex information into actionable insights. Furthermore, understanding the biases and limitations of different information sources is critical for avoiding flawed analyses. A well-informed trader possesses a significant advantage in navigating the dynamic landscape of prediction markets.
Data analysis plays a pivotal role in identifying patterns, trends, and correlations that might influence event outcomes. Examining historical data, conducting statistical modeling, and employing machine learning algorithms can reveal hidden insights that are not readily apparent through conventional analysis. Exploring alternative data sources, such as social media sentiment analysis or satellite imagery, can provide unique perspectives on evolving events. The ability to effectively analyze and interpret data is a key differentiator between successful and unsuccessful traders in the prediction market space. The more robust your analytical foundation, the better equipped you are to make informed decisions and capitalize on emerging opportunities.
